MST

星途 面试题库

面试题:Node.js 中 Express 解决 CORS 跨域问题之基础设置

在 Node.js 的 Express 应用中,如何使用 `cors` 中间件来简单配置允许所有来源的跨域请求?请写出关键代码片段。
16.9万 热度难度
前端开发Node.js

知识考点

AI 面试

面试题答案

一键面试
  1. 首先安装 cors 包:
npm install cors
  1. 在 Express 应用中使用 cors 中间件允许所有来源的跨域请求,关键代码如下:
const express = require('express');
const cors = require('cors');
const app = express();

app.use(cors());

// 其他路由和中间件设置
const port = 3000;
app.listen(port, () => {
  console.log(`Server running on port ${port}`);
});